Why Bespoke Website Designs Matter for Your Brand


A bespoke website design is all about creating something unique just for you. It’s not about picking a pre-made template and slapping your logo on it. Instead, it’s a thoughtful process that considers your brand’s personality, goals, and audience.


Here’s why bespoke designs are so valuable:


  • Reflect Your Brand Identity: Your website should feel like an extension of your business. Custom designs allow you to use your brand colours, fonts, and style in a way that feels authentic.

  • Improve User Experience: Bespoke sites are built with your customers in mind. This means easy navigation, clear calls to action, and a layout that guides visitors naturally.

  • Boost Credibility: A professional, unique website builds trust. Visitors are more likely to stay and explore if your site looks polished and well thought out.

  • Flexible and Scalable: As your business grows, your website can evolve with you. Custom designs make it easier to add new features or update content without limitations.

What Makes a Bespoke Website Design Different?


You might wonder what exactly sets bespoke website designs apart from standard options. Here’s a simple breakdown:


  1. Discovery and Planning

    We start by understanding your business, goals, and audience. This step ensures the design aligns perfectly with your brand.


  2. Custom Visual Design

    Every element - from colours to typography to layout - is created specifically for you. This is where your brand’s personality comes to life.


  3. Tailored Functionality

    Need a booking system, online store, or blog? Bespoke designs can include exactly what you need without unnecessary extras.


  4. SEO and Performance Optimisation

    Your site will be built to load quickly and rank well on search engines, helping you attract more visitors.


  5. Ongoing Support and Updates

    A bespoke website isn’t just a one-time project. It’s a partnership where your site grows with your business.


This approach contrasts with off-the-shelf templates that often force you to fit your brand into a pre-existing mould. With bespoke design, the website fits your brand perfectly.

Here are some final tips to ensure your bespoke site delivers a unique brand identity:


  • Keep It Simple and Clear

Avoid clutter. A clean design with clear messaging helps visitors understand your value quickly.


  • Use Authentic Visuals

Original photos or custom graphics make your site feel genuine and trustworthy.


  • Tell Your Story

Share your business journey, values, and what makes you different. People connect with stories.


  • Make Contact Easy

Prominent contact details and calls to action encourage visitors to reach out.


  • Regularly Update Your Site

Keep your content fresh and relevant to maintain engagement and improve SEO.
